"In this updated edition Faux details recent challenges and erosions to the decision - including parental consent laws and bans on partial-birth abortions - and illuminates how the ruling has impacted public attitudes and policy. Dominating health care funding, religious ideologies, and party platforms, Roe v. Wade is a revolutionary decision that remains besieged and defended in equal measure, an issue in perpetual motion with little hope for either a decisive victory or a peaceful compromise.
